One such means that has come to the fore in prior scandals is\u00a0<a href=\"http:\/\/www.editage.com\/insights\/authorship-for-sale\">paying to have one\u2019s name appear as one of the authors of a paper<\/a>. The recent announcement by a major publisher,\u00a0<a href=\"http:\/\/www.sagepublications.com\/\">SAGE<\/a>,\u00a0that it is retracting as many as 60 papers in one go that appeared in <a href=\"http:\/\/jvc.sagepub.com\/\">the<em> Journal of Vibration and Control<\/em><\/a>,\u00a0has exposed yet another unethical means to easy publication &#8211; rigging the review process using false identities. These fake names represent independent reviewers who can be guaranteed to provide a favourable review, recommending publication. The blog <a href=\"http:\/\/retractionwatch.com\/\">Retraction Watch<\/a> broke the <a href=\"http:\/\/retractionwatch.com\/2014\/07\/08\/sage-publications-busts-peer-review-and-citation-ring-60-papers-retracted\/\">story<\/a>, which was picked up by several influential publications including<em> The Washington Post<\/em>, which reports that the ring involved <a href=\"http:\/\/www.washingtonpost.com\/news\/morning-mix\/wp\/2014\/07\/11\/the-most-brazen-peer-review-scandal-anyone-can-remember\/\">\u2018up to 130 [such fake identities] in an apparently successful effort to get friendly reviews of submissions and as many articles published as possible\u2019<\/a>. In one case, the author reviewed that paper himself using a false identity he had created earlier. The Education Minister of Taiwan,\u00a0<\/span><\/span><span style=\"font-family: verdana, geneva, sans-serif; font-size: 14px;\">Chiang Wei-ling,\u00a0<\/span><span style=\"font-family: verdana, geneva, sans-serif; font-size: 14px;\">has resigned in the wake of the scandal, as his name appears on several of the retracted papers.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span style=\"font-size:14px;\"><span style=\"font-family:verdana,geneva,sans-serif;\">Regardless of how further investigations proceed, the SAGE case highlights the need for academics to be alert, because in some instances real names and real institutions were used without the knowledge of the scientists thus impersonated.
